Summary

On 23 May 2006 at about 14:30 local time, a Piper PA-32-260 registered N412PM was involved in an accident near Laconia, New Hampshire, United States. 3 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

The pilot's failure to maintain directional control during the landing.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

During the landing on runway 26, and shortly after touchdown, the Piper PA-32-260 began to "hop" to the right. The airplane then departed the runway surface, and continued on the grass until the landing gear collapsed, resulting in substantial damage. The pilot did not report any mechanical anomalies with the airplane. The winds at the time of the accident were from 300 degrees at 13 knots, gusting to 20 knots.
